    Who are we looking for?

    This field-based role supports mining and oil and gas operations by promoting safe work practices, regulatory compliance, and continuous improvement.

    GHD has an opening in Questa, NM for a Water Treatment Plant Coordinator with experience in mining and oil and gas operations.

    Primary Responsibilities

    • Provide field safety support for mining and oil and gas projects.

    • Lead or support safety meetings, training, inspections, audits, and incident investigations.

    • Develop, implement, monitor, and improve site safety programs.

    • Ensure compliance with federal, state, local, and client-specific requirements.

    • Manage and administer permit-to-work programs.

    • Monitor subcontractor safety performance and field compliance.

    • Conduct/support incident investigations, root cause analyses, and corrective action tracking.

    • Lead site inspections, audits, and HSE assessments.

    • Maintain training records and coordinate onboarding and training for employees and visitors.

    • Support hazardous waste management and environmental monitoring activities.

    • Maintain gas detection equipment and emergency response readiness.

    • Participate in Management of Change (MOC) and Pre-Startup Safety Reviews (PSSR).

    • Identify hazards, recommend corrective actions, and support compliance with company and regulatory requirements.

    • Review safety plans, JSAs, and field documentation to support safe project execution.

    • Track HSE performance, manage reporting, and support injury case management as needed.

    • Partner with project teams to promote proactive safety leadership in the field.

    Qualifications/Requirements

    • Degree or diploma in occupational safety, environmental health, or a related field, or equivalent experience.

    • 5+ years of health and safety experience in mining, oil and gas, construction, or other high-hazard operations.

    • Mining, water treatment, hazardous waste, or industrial operations experience.

    • OSHA, MSHA, CHST, CSP, or equivalent certifications preferred.

    • Knowledge of HSE management systems, risk assessment, incident investigation, and applicable safety regulations.

    • Strong communication, field coaching, and problem-solving skills.

    • Proficiency with Microsoft Office and a valid driver's license.

    • Ability to work independently in the field and travel as needed.
